開源安全工具大揭秘:開發者必備的安全工具箱
在軟件開發的過程中,安全問題一直是開發者們最為關注的問題之一。為了保證應用程序的安全性和穩定性,開發者們需要選擇適合自己的安全工具,并且不斷更新優化,使其達到更好的效果。
本文將為大家介紹一些開源的安全工具,這些工具適用于各種開發環境,并且功能強大,易于使用。如果你是一名開發者,那么這些工具絕對是你必備的安全工具箱。
1. OWASP ZAP
OWASP ZAP是一款功能強大的Web應用程序安全掃描器,能夠幫助開發者發現應用程序中的安全漏洞。它支持各種Web應用程序測試,包括注入漏洞、跨站點腳本攻擊等。該軟件特別適用于開發Web程序的開發者,可以幫助他們發現應用程序的安全問題。
2. Nmap
Nmap是一款非常強大的網絡開發工具,它可以幫助開發者發現網絡中的漏洞,以及識別各種網絡服務。它支持各種操作系統和平臺,并且能夠對網絡攻擊進行防御。Nmap是一款非常流行的網絡安全工具,應該是每個開發者的必備工具之一。
3. Metasploit
Metasploit是一款非常流行的滲透測試工具,特別適用于網絡安全專業人員和安全研究人員。它集成了多種漏洞攻擊工具,包括端口掃描、漏洞利用、密碼爆破等功能。它是一款開源的軟件,可以通過其模塊化框架快速定制攻擊測試流程。
4. Wireshark
Wireshark是一款網絡協議分析工具,它可以捕獲和分析網絡數據包并進行詳細的展示。該軟件支持多種協議,包括TCP、UDP、HTTP、SMTP等。開發者可以通過使用Wireshark來分析應用程序中的通信流量,以發現任何安全問題。
5. Snort
Snort是一款輕量級的網絡入侵檢測系統,它可以幫助開發者監控應用程序和網絡中的流量。該軟件基于規則匹配技術,可以檢測各種攻擊事件,并向開發者發出警報。它還支持多種網絡協議,包括TCP、UDP、ICMP等。
總結:
安全是應用程序開發的核心問題之一,選擇合適的安全工具可以幫助開發者及時解決安全問題。本文介紹了一些開源的安全工具,它們可以幫助開發者發現應用程序中的安全漏洞,對應用程序的安全性進行全面的保護。無論你是一名開發者還是網絡安全專業人員,都應該擁有這些工具并不斷運用它們,使應用程序更加安全和可靠。
以上就是IT培訓機構千鋒教育提供的相關內容,如果您有web前端培訓,鴻蒙開發培訓,python培訓,linux培訓,java培訓,UI設計培訓等需求,歡迎隨時聯系千鋒教育。